Keeneland

Keeneland Race Course held its first live race in 1936. Keeneland has maintained many of the old-time horse racing charms and was the last race track in North America to broadcast race calls over the public-address system. This was not done until 1997. Keeneland hosts a number of preps for the Kentucky Derby during the spring meet, while the fall meet features numerous preps for the Breeders’ Cup. Because Keeneland has maintained the same appearance for most of its history is was used as the setting for many of the racing scenes in the 2003 film Seabscuit.

Keeneland

Main Track: One and one-sixteenth miles, oval.
Turf Course: Seven and one-half furlongs, oval.
Distance from last turn to finish line: 1,174 feet

Exotic Wagering Format
$1. Daily Double on races 1 & 2, 3 & 4 and last two races.
$1. Exacta on all races.
$2. Quinella on all races.
$1. Trifectas on all races with five or more betting interests.
$1. "Rolling" Pick 3 begins on 1st race.
$2. Pick 6 on last six races.
$0.10 Superfecta on all races with 6 or more betting interests.
$1. Pick 4 on races 2-5, 4-7 and last four races.

Takeout Information
Win, place, and show: 16%
Pick 3, 4 and 6: 17%
All other wagers: 19%
